Re: [ogfs-users]mkfs.ogfs problems



On Monday 15 December 2003 07:15 pm, Franco Broi wrote:
> I want to add journals for up to 32 clients, shouldn't this work?

Theoretically, but the performance of the cluster/lock transport (i.e. gigE, 
etc.) is going to hit it's limits before you get there I think.

> 
> mkfs.ogfs -p memexp -t /dev/data22/data22_cidev -i -j 32
> /dev/data22/data22
> mkfs.ogfs: Error opening the mkfs configuration file ""
> 
> The manual says that the configuration file is optional, or must I list
> all the internal journals in the config file?

Internal journals should be able to be specified on the cmd line. If that 
isn't true, could you file a bug about it?

> 
> Plus, if I want to use a single external device for several journals,
> how do I define this in the journal.cf file?

This isn't supported. each external journal has to have it's own partition.
